Senecio peregrinus
Trailing stems adorned with distinct, firm teardrop-shaped green succulent leaves—sometimes with lovely variegation—set this plant apart from the perfectly round “String of Pearls.” It thrives in very bright indirect light or full sun; however, be cautious, as low light can lead to its decline. Ensure to water generously, but make certain the soil dries out completely between watering sessions to prevent any risk of root rot.
